Is Bitcoin Out Of Its Bear Market? These Analysts Think So

Bitcoin is out of its bear market. But expect a possible pullback. 

That’s according to analysts at crypto research firm CryptoQuant, who say the coin is behaving like it has done in the past. CryptoQuant founder, Ki Young Ju, wrote on X Tuesday that the asset had “entered into the early bull phase.”

Ju Pointed to movements bitcoin made in its last cycle before entering a bull market, and said the coin was currently doing the same thing. 

CryptoQuant research shows that bitcoin flows to derivative exchanges have started again, confirming that traders have entered “risk-on” mode, which “has marked the start of a new bull cycle” in the past. 

And another analyst at the firm, Theophiluspep, wrote that while the coin was entering a bull market, “spot demand, ETF flows, and market momentum have turned decisively bullish, but elevated profit-taking, exchange inflows, and overbought conditions suggest a potential near-term cooldown.”

He added: “This looks increasingly like a genuine regime shift into the early phase of a new bull market, driven more by improving spot demand and institutional ETF buying than by excessive leverage.”

Bitcoin started surging last week. It is currently up 22% over a seven-day period and was recently priced at $78,716. It briefly touched $81,160 on Monday. 

Its rise comes after a sluggish June and July when it mostly traded below $65,000. 

U.S. investors last week reversed course and bought up shares in the bitcoin exchange-traded funds, which had their best week since October — the same time bitcoin notched its record of $126,080. 

Data from Farside Investors shows that the funds — managed by the likes of BlackRock, Fidelity, Grayscale, and Morgan Stanley — received $1.9 billion in new cash. 

The change in sentiment comes after the Treasury Department’s announcement last week to at least double the size of its long-dated bond buybacks.

Since the Treasury made the announcement, yields have gone down, while bitcoin and gold have shot up. The dollar last week was trading at a three-month low and on track for its worst week of August. Bitcoin, on the other hand, had its best week since 2023. 

Positive regulatory news coming out of the White House also helped: President Donald Trump held a meeting with crypto executives earlier last week, and urged lawmakers to get the Clarity Act over the line.
